The Leo Triplet

My image of the Leo Triplet was taken with my 1300D DSLR Canon camera. The camera was mounted on my 80ED APO Skywatcher Refractor telescope with a field flattener. The telescope was mounted on my EQ5 GOTO MOUNT. Settings were 50s and 800ISO. I captured 130 images, 30 flat frames and 30 dark frames. All were stacked in Sequator, processed in Siril and finished of in Gimp 2.10 using star reduction. I used an intervalometer to control the camera and a Bahtinov mask to focus on a bright star.
